When you employ a personal injury lawyer you will be provided with a retainer agreement. This is a written contract which outlines how the relationship between the lawyer and the client will function. The retainer agreement should also define the percentage that will be paid to the attorney. The amount that is retained should be reasonable, taking into account the nature of the case and the amount of time to be spent on the case.

The typical contingency fees for a personal injury case are one third or 33 percent of the gross recovery. The percentage could be higher in more complicated cases. The percentage of attorney fees charged will vary based on the attorney’s risk and the amount of expenses paid.

The "per diem" method is another method to calculate compensation for suffering and pain. This method assigns a dollar amount for each day from the date of the accident and the date that is the most likely to recover. It is crucial to note that "per per" is a Latin term which means "per day". The multiplier method is a typical way of calculating the value of an injury claim. It usually ranges between one and five.

The multiplier method may be affected by permanent impairment, future medical expenses, and loss of earning capacity. Witnesses may be required to testify regarding future medical treatment costs.
